FIRST MOTION FOR EXTENSION OF TIME
TO FILE APPELLANT’S BRIEF
TO THE HONORABLE JUSTICES OF THE COURT OF APPEALS:
Comes Now, Anthony James Garcia, Appellant, and files this Motion for
Extension of Time to File Appellant’s Brief under Rules 10.5(b) and 38.6(d) of the
Texas Rules of Appellate Procedure, and would show:
I.
The deadline for filing Appellant’s brief is July 5, 2017. Appellant has
received no previous extensions of time to file his brief.
II.
Appellant hereby requests a sixty-two (62) day extension of time to file his
brief until September 5, 2017. This request is based on the following:
1. The undersigned, who is a solo practitioner, had to undergo major surgery
in May and has been recuperating from it. She is attempting to take care of
matters she has been unable to attend to. These matters include, but are not
limited to, appellate briefs in Levi Turner vs. The State of Texas, No. 13-
1 17-00227-CR; and Felix Pina vs. The State of Texas, No. 03-17-00129-
CR.
2. The undersigned’s support staff will be on vacation June 26 – July 10,
2017.
3. This extension of time is necessary to accord Appellant with effective
assistance of counsel on appeal.
WHEREFORE, PREMISES CONSIDERED, Appellant requests that this
Court grant a sixty-two (62) day extension of time to file his brief until September
5, 2017.
